I went to Curry's Auto Service once to replace an alternator for my 951. (I hadn't found Dr. John's yet.) They sold me an alternator, not even Bosch, for $468. Just for the part! The whole swap was well approaching $700.
They also gave me a $2200 estimate for a leaking steering rack, which I later had fixed somewhere else for way under half that amount.
I can't comment on their knowledge of the 944 since it was just an alternator, but they are very pricey as far as I can tell.
